What is Wisconsin Form 4M

The Wisconsin Form 4M Combined Group Member Data is a tax document used by members of a combined group to report their share of unitary income, losses, and credits to the Wisconsin Department of Revenue.

Wisconsin Form 4M is needed by:
  • Businesses operating in Wisconsin with combined group status
  • Tax professionals handling state tax filings for clients
  • Accountants preparing tax documents for multiple entity structures
  • Financial officers of companies needing to report unitary income
  • Corporations with operations affecting combined tax group filings
